#13b6be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#13b6be is composed of 7.5% red, 71.4% green and 74.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 90% cyan, 4.2% magenta, 0% yellow and 25.5% black. It has a hue angle of 182.8 degrees, a saturation of 81.8% and a lightness of 41%. #13b6be color hex could be obtained by blending #26ffff with #006d7d. Closest websafe color is: #00cccc.

Shades and Tints of #13b6be
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010b0c is the darkest color, while #f9fefe is the lightest one.
